Solicitor/Associate Solicitor – Family – Birmingham

Vacancy details

Due to our continued success, we have a new opportunity for a Solicitor or Associate Solicitor to join our reputable family team in Birmingham on a full-time basis. Spanning our Taunton, Bristol, Birmingham, Southampton and Manchester offices, our well-regarded family team is growing. Led by 6 Partners nationally, you will be working on highly complex cases, benefitting from the support of our wider team. Ranked Tier 2 in the Legal 500 and Band 2 in Chambers our Birmingham team is well-equipped to develop and progress your career.

This position is a hybrid role, based out of our Birmingham city centre office where you will work with a talented and friendly team, that comprises of two Partners, a Chartered Legal Executive (Senior Associate), the three of which are ranked in Chambers and the Legal 500, a Trainee Legal Executive and a Paralegal.

This is an excellent opportunity for an individual who is experienced in handling high quality family law matters to include both privately funded financial remedy work, private children law and cohabitation disputes. You will work with a client base that comprises of professional clients, high net worth individuals, those with business interests and those in the sports and agricultural sectors.
